I watched Machination on a whim on Tubi. I didn't know anything about it, but I liked the cover art and had some time to kill. I watch an unhealthy number of low budget random horror films and expected this to be the same. Boy was I wrong. This is an exceptional film all about one woman's descent into madness and paranoia while living in isolation at the onset of the pandemic.
I enjoyed all aspects of this film, but all the credit goes to Steffi Thake as the lead actor. The whole film rests on her shoulders and her performance is mesmerizing. We watch her go from taking a lot of the same precautions many of us did to complete shut down. Almost the entire movie is just her in her house, and it works. As someone who isolated by myself for months in the early covid days I could relate to a lot of the paranoia and fear. I don't know anything about Thake but I will be sure to watch out for other projects with her. Be sure to check this out. This is the first film I've seen that effectively brings out those fears we all had early in the pandemic.

I can understand several things about making movies. Firstly, they are difficult to make and anyone who does so, especially on a small budget, will always have my admiration. Secondly, doing the first thing whilst under a Covid lockdown must be doubly difficult.
That being said, this is really poor stuff. Thankfully, it is a really short movie, 62 minutes and done. Which makes me feel that with the editing being being rather 'generous', it might have been an idea to simply make a 20 minute short and have done with it.
